#5大维度构建企业级智能数字标牌系统:从技术选型到ROI提升实践
【免费下载链接】LibreSignageA free and open source digital signage solution.项目地址: https://gitcode.com/gh_mirrors/li/LibreSignage
行业痛点分析
现代企业在信息传递过程中面临三大核心挑战:传统公告方式信息触达率不足42%,多地点屏幕内容同步延迟超过2小时,以及跨平台设备管理成本占IT预算18%。据行业调研显示,零售场景中静态标牌的顾客停留时间平均仅12秒,而动态内容展示可使信息接收效率提升37%。这些痛点催生了对智能化数字标牌系统的迫切需求,尤其是在连锁门店、校园和企业办公等多场景应用中。
技术选型指南
部署架构对比
| 架构类型 | 初始投入 | 扩展性 | 维护成本 | 适用场景 |
|---|---|---|---|---|
| 本地部署 | 高(服务器+运维) | 有限 | 高(需专职IT) | 大型企业/数据敏感场景 |
| Docker容器 | 中(单节点部署) | 中(横向扩展) | 中(容器化管理) | 中型组织/多分支结构 |
| K8s集群 | 高(集群建设) | 高(弹性伸缩) | 中高(需DevOps支持) | 大型连锁/跨区域运营 |
内容分发协议评估
- HTTP/HTTPS:部署简单但实时性不足,适合非紧急静态内容,带宽占用较高
- WebSocket:双向实时通信,延迟<100ms,适合应急信息发布,服务器资源消耗较大
- MQTT:轻量级发布订阅模式,带宽占用低,适合物联网设备集群,需额外消息代理
系统功能矩阵
// 核心功能模块评估示例(src/common/php/Config.php 配置片段) $config = [ 'content_management' => [ 'support_formats' => ['image', 'video', 'text', 'html5'], // 内容格式支持度 'scheduling' => true, // 时间线编排能力 'versioning' => true // 内容版本控制 ], 'device_management' => [ 'remote_control' => true, // 远程设备控制 'status_monitoring' => true, // 设备状态监控 'firmware_update' => true // 固件升级支持 ] ];模块化组件解析
内容管理模块
场景问题:多部门内容审批流程冗长导致信息发布延迟
技术原理:基于角色的访问控制(RBAC)与工作流引擎
实施工具:src/control/editor/js/EditorController.js提供内容编辑与权限管理
验证指标:内容发布周期从3天缩短至4小时,审批效率提升65%
关键代码实现:
// 内容发布权限验证(异常处理示例) async function publishContent(content, userId) { try { // 权限检查 const hasPermission = await UserController.checkPermission(userId, 'publish'); if (!hasPermission) { throw new Error('E001: 权限不足,无法发布内容'); } // 内容验证 const isValid = EditorValidators.validate(content); if (!isValid) { throw new Error('E002: 内容格式验证失败'); } // 发布逻辑 return await ContentService.publish(content); } catch (e) { Log.error(`发布失败: ${e.message}`); // 日志记录 throw e; // 向上传递异常 } }设备控制模块
场景问题:多屏幕设备状态监控困难,故障发现滞后
技术原理:基于WebSocket的实时状态同步与心跳检测
实施工具:src/app/js/DisplayController.js提供设备管理功能
验证指标:设备故障响应时间从平均4小时缩短至15分钟
用户权限模块
场景问题:权限管理混乱导致信息安全风险
技术原理:基于JWT的认证机制与细粒度权限控制
实施工具:src/common/php/auth/Auth.php处理用户认证与授权
验证指标:权限相关安全事件减少82%
环境适配方案
Docker部署流程
# 1. 克隆仓库 git clone https://gitcode.com/gh_mirrors/li/LibreSignage cd LibreSignage # 2. 构建镜像(含参数说明) docker build -t libresignage:latest \ --build-arg PHP_VERSION=7.4 \ # 指定PHP版本 --build-arg APACHE_MODULES=rewrite # 启用Apache重写模块 . # 3. 运行容器(含端口映射与数据持久化) docker run -d -p 80:80 \ -v ./data:/app/data \ # 数据持久化 -v ./config:/app/config \ # 配置文件映射 --name signage-server \ libresignage:latestK8s部署要点
- 使用ConfigMap管理应用配置
- 部署StatefulSet确保稳定网络标识
- 配置HorizontalPodAutoscaler实现弹性伸缩
- 使用Ingress控制外部访问
实施流程图解
┌─────────────────┐ ┌─────────────────┐ ┌─────────────────┐ │ 环境准备阶段 │ │ 系统部署阶段 │ │ 内容运营阶段 │ │ │ │ │ │ │ │ 1. 硬件兼容性 │────▶│ 1. 容器化部署 │────▶│ 1. 内容创建 │ │ 测试 │ │ 2. 数据库配置 │ │ 2. 排期管理 │ │ 2. 网络带宽 │ │ 3. 安全策略 │ │ 3. 效果分析 │ │ 评估 │ │ 配置 │ │ 4. 迭代优化 │ └─────────────────┘ └─────────────────┘ └─────────────────┘ │ │ │ ▼ ▼ ▼ ┌─────────────────┐ ┌─────────────────┐ ┌─────────────────┐ │ 关键指标: │ │ 关键指标: │ │ 关键指标: │ │ - 设备兼容性 │ │ - 服务可用性 │ │ - 内容更新频率 │ │ - 网络延迟 │ │ - 数据安全性 │ │ - 用户互动率 │ └─────────────────┘ └─────────────────┘ └─────────────────┘案例迁移路径
阶段一:基础设施构建(1-2周)
- 服务器环境配置与安全加固
- 数据库初始化与备份策略建立
- 基础网络架构部署(负载均衡、CDN)
阶段二:系统部署与测试(2-3周)
- 应用系统容器化部署
- 设备接入与通信测试
- 功能模块集成测试
- 性能压力测试(支持500+并发设备)
阶段三:内容迁移与培训(1-2周)
- 历史内容格式转换与导入
- 管理员与编辑用户培训
- 内容发布流程试运行
阶段四:优化与扩展(持续)
- 基于用户反馈优化界面
- 性能监控与系统调优
- 新功能模块扩展(如AI内容推荐)
ROI计算器框架
投入成本
- 硬件投入:服务器($3000-8000)、显示设备($500-2000/台)
- 软件许可:开源系统($0)、定制开发($5000-15000)
- 部署实施:实施服务($3000-8000)、培训($1000-3000)
维护成本
- 人力成本:专职管理员($6000-10000/月)
- 基础设施:服务器维护($200-500/月)、带宽($100-300/月)
- 内容制作:设计与制作($2000-5000/月)
收益分析
- 直接收益:印刷成本节约($500-2000/月)、营销转化率提升(15-30%)
- 间接收益:信息更新效率提升(70-90%)、员工沟通成本降低(30-50%)
- 投资回报期:小型部署(<10屏)约6-8个月,中型部署(10-50屏)约8-12个月
多屏协同算法解析
多屏协同系统采用分布式时间同步机制,通过以下技术实现精准内容同步:
- NTP时间校准:所有设备每小时进行一次NTP时间同步,误差控制在50ms以内
- 内容预加载:提前10分钟加载下一时间段内容,避免播放中断
- 断点续传:采用HTTP Range请求实现大文件断点续传,确保视频内容完整传输
- 冲突解决:基于优先级的内容播放冲突解决策略,应急信息优先级别最高
核心算法实现:
// 多屏同步策略(src/app/js/DisplayView.js 核心片段) class SyncManager { constructor() { this.timeSyncThreshold = 50; // 时间同步阈值(ms) this.contentPreloadTime = 600; // 内容预加载时间(s) } async checkSyncStatus() { const serverTime = await TimeService.getServerTime(); const localTime = Date.now(); const timeDiff = Math.abs(serverTime - localTime); if (timeDiff > this.timeSyncThreshold) { this.adjustLocalTime(serverTime); this.rescheduleContent(); } return timeDiff <= this.timeSyncThreshold; } }内容效果评估矩阵
| 评估维度 | 量化指标 | 数据来源 | 优化方向 |
|---|---|---|---|
| 内容吸引力 | 平均停留时间>3秒 | 摄像头分析/热区图 | 优化视觉设计与内容布局 |
| 信息传达 | 关键信息识别率>85% | 用户调研/问卷调查 | 简化信息层级,突出核心内容 |
| 互动效果 | 互动率>5% | 交互日志分析 | 增加互动元素与调用动作 |
| 转化效果 | 目标达成率>20% | 销售数据/行为追踪 | A/B测试不同内容策略 |
总结与展望
企业级数字标牌系统已从简单的信息展示工具演进为智能化的信息发布平台。通过本文阐述的"问题-方案-实践"框架,组织可以系统性地规划数字标牌项目,从技术选型到实施落地,再到效果评估,实现可量化的业务价值提升。
随着AI技术与物联网的深度融合,未来数字标牌系统将向个性化内容推荐、情感识别交互、AR增强现实等方向发展。建议组织在实施过程中采用模块化架构,为未来功能扩展预留接口,同时建立完善的数据收集与分析机制,持续优化内容策略,最大化投资回报。
选择适合自身需求的数字标牌解决方案,不仅能提升信息传递效率,更能构建全新的用户体验与品牌互动方式,在数字化转型浪潮中获得竞争优势。
【免费下载链接】LibreSignageA free and open source digital signage solution.项目地址: https://gitcode.com/gh_mirrors/li/LibreSignage
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考